Heartbreaking: Pensioner Dies After Crash Near Strood

A 73-year-old woman has died in hospital following a collision on the A228 Sundridge Hill near Strood. The tragic crash happened on Friday, 10 January 2020, and involved a grey Citroen C4 Picasso and the pensioner, who was pushing her bicycle at the time.

Victim Airlifted, Later Passes Away

The elderly woman, from Rochester, was airlifted to a London hospital with serious injuries but sadly passed away on 20 January. The scene is still under investigation by Kent Police’s Serious Collision Investigation Unit.

Police Renew Plea For Witnesses

A 43-year-old Rochester woman arrested over the collision has been released while inquiries continue. Officers are urging anyone who witnessed the crash or has dashcam footage to come forward.
